The manufacturing process
Fermentation:Starch is extracted from plants and converted into glucose (sugar). Microorganisms then ferment the glucose to produce lactic acid.
Polymerization:The lactic acid molecules are chemically linked together to form long polymer chains. This can be done directly or by first creating a ring-shaped molecule called lactide and then polymerizing it.
Extrusion:The resulting polylactic acid polymer is heated and melted, then pushed through a nozzle to create a thin, continuous filament.
Cooling and spooling:The filament is rapidly cooled to maintain its shape and then wound onto a spool for use in 3D printers.
